Heymondo offers three different insurance plans designed to suit a wide range of travelers, from short-term tourists to digital nomads staying abroad for months at a time.

Single-Trip Plan

This plan is ideal for short-term travelers and can be used for trips as short as one day.
You can choose from three coverage options — Top, Premium, and Medical — with maximum coverage of up to $10 million.

Single-Trip Plan Coverage
  • Emergency medical & dental expenses overseas: $5 million – $10 million
  • Medical transport & repatriation home: $500,000
  • Baggage protection: $1,700 – $2,500
  • Travel disruption: $450 – $1,500

Annual Multi-Trip Plan

This plan is perfect for frequent travelers who take multiple international trips throughout the year, including visits to the United States.

It provides coverage for up to 60 days per year and applies worldwide.

Annual Multi-Trip Plan Coverage
  • Emergency medical & dental expenses overseas: $10 million
  • Medical transport & repatriation home: $500,000
  • Baggage protection: $2,500
  • Travel disruption: $1,500

Long-Stay Plan

Designed for digital nomads and long-term travelers, this plan offers a three-month coverage period with comprehensive protection starting at just $53.80 per month.

Long-Stay Plan Coverage
  • Emergency medical & dental expenses overseas: $2.5 million
  • Medical transport & repatriation home: $500,000
  • Baggage protection: $1,200
  • Travel disruption: $300

Heymondo Coverage Overview

Let’s take a closer look at the insurance details provided by Heymondo.

The table below summarizes the coverage included in the Single-Trip Plan.

Insurance DetailsInsurance Limit
Medical Insurance$5,000,000
Emergency Dental Care$300
Extended Overnight Expenses$1,800
Emergency Transportation$5,000,000
Baggage coverage$1,700
Flight delays$450
Interruption of travel
(return to your country)
$3,500
At the time of death$100,000

Other Heymondo plans offer the same types of coverage as listed above, but the coverage limits may vary.

However, the Travel Insurance (Medical) plan does not include baggage protection or travel interruption coverage.

Important Considerations When Joining Heymondo

Before purchasing Heymondo insurance, keep the following points in mind:

Key Precautions for Heymondo
  • Age Limit
    : Individuals over 50 years old cannot enroll.
  • Dental Coverage
    : Emergency dental treatment is covered up to $300.
  • Deductibles
    : Some plans other than the Travel Insurance option include deductibles.
  • Waiting Period
    : If you sign up while already traveling, a 72-hour waiting period applies before full coverage begins.
